SCMA Files Prompt Pay Legislation

The SCMA has filed Prompt Pay legislation in the South Carolina Senate.  Senate Bill 974 was filed on February 10th and would provide physicians protection from many of the unfair business tactics of health insurers in South Carolina.  This language is similar to that passed in many other states and contains many provisions included in the legal settlements with the health insurers.
